If you are into riding rock gardens have we think we have got a trail for you to try out. The Old Santa Susana Stage Rd Trail is basically a trail made of rocks. It's not that long and there are other trails to ride in the same area but if you want to test your rock crawling skills then you may enjoy it. If you plan on riding it fast just make sure you have the suspension for it and a full face helmet! It's kind of a cool trail since it's pretty much solid rock and stands out from the rest of the trails in the area.

This trail is in the same area as the Rocky Peak trail system just on the other side of the freeway and offers some other semi interesting trails to ride while you are out there. The rock garden part of the trail is little less than a mile long but will take some time to finish because you will be going pretty slow... if you are smart! It's pretty much all going down too so there is no riding up the rocks unless you come back the same way. And there will definitely be some places you will be walking your bike unless you are really good or really brave.

The Old Santa Susana Stage Rd Trail is one of those trails you do once just to see how well you can do and then move on. It's more of a challenge than it is fun so once you finish it you really don't feel like doing it again. And if you decide to walk back up it you really won't want to do it again! You most likely will be riding your brakes the whole time and trying not to go over the handlebars since it's really unpredictable because there are so many ways to get your tire stuck in a groove in the rocks.

We have done this trail using a variety of bikes and the more suspension and more downhill geometry you have the better. If you had a downhill bike you could probably go pretty fast on the trail and have a good time. If you don't feel comfortable riding over rocky terrain and trails like Hummingbird and Chumash scare you then don't give this tail any consideration. If you do decide to do it then you can check out the other trails around the area. There is nothing too exciting in the area in general and you will end up in Chatsworth eventually if you keep going down. And you will be doing some climbing to get yourself back out to the Rocky Peak area. And no it's not worth doing a 2 car shuttle so don't waste your time.

Directions to the Santa Susana Stage Rd Trail


View Old Santa Susana Stage Road in a larger map

To get to the Old Santa Susana Stage Rd Trail take the 118 freeway into Simi Valley to the Rocky Peak exit and head west away from the Rocky Peak trailhead. You can either park on Santa Susana Pass Rd and find the trail that leads down to the trail entrance on Lilac Ln or drive down Lilac Ln itself and there is a small dirt area to park where the trail system starts. Then when you get on the trails stay off to the right and you will hit the rocky part of the trail. Check out the map on this page to show you exactly how to get there.
